    基于局部椭圆变形的长输管道内检测的实践应用

    Practice and Application of Long Distance Pipeline Internal Inspection Based on Local Elliptic Deformation

    • 摘要: 论述了基于局部椭圆变形的长输管道,在无法实施局部换管的特定条件下如何实施内检测工作的应用实践。通过对漏磁检测设备的连接臂、皮碗法兰和探头进行改造,提升了检测设备在3D(内径)弯管处的通过能力,实现了不发生卡球事故的安全目标。通过对现场实测数据和内检测报告数据的分析比对,验证了内检测数据量化精度达到Rosen公司标准。为今后在长输管道局部椭圆变形及其他变形的特定条件下,实施内检测工作积累了实践经验,为类似管道的内检测、技术管理和安全运营提供了一定的借鉴作用。

       

      Abstract: The application practice of how to carry out internal inspection of long distance pipeline with local elliptic deformation under the specific condition that local pipe change cannot be carried out was discussed. Through the modification of the connecting arm, the cup flange and the probe of the magnetic flux leakage (MFL) testing equipment, the passing ability of the testing equipment at the 3D (inner diameter) bend were improved, and the safety goal of no stuck pigging accident was realized. Through the field measurement analysis and comparison of the internal detection data, it was verified that the quantization accuracy of the internal detection data reached the Rosen standard. The practical experience was accumulated for carrying out internal inspection work under the specific conditions of local elliptic deformation and other deformation of long-distance pipeline in the future, and provided a certain reference for the internal inspection, technical management and safe operation of similar pipelines.
